#833423 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#833423 is composed of 51.4% red, 20.4%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.3% magenta, 73.3%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 10.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 32.5%. #833423 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6846 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#833423 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#833423 has RGB values of R:131, G:52,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.73,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8598563.

Shades and Tints of #833423
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070302 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#833423
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565150 is the less saturated color, while #a31f03 is the most saturated one.
